On August 31,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um held her morning press conference, known as 'La Mañanera,' to address key issues in her administration and answer questions from the press. The event took place at the Escuela Secundaria Técnica No.10 'Artes Gráficas' in Mexico City, coinciding with the start of the school year. Sheinbaum was accompanied by members of her cabinet and honored the national flag with the school's honor guard. The head of the Mexico City government, Clara Brugada, announced a security operation involving 15,000 police officers deployed to protect schools, crosswalks, streets, and public transportation during the return to classes. Sheinbaum emphasized the importance of transforming schools into the best public spaces and highlighted education as a priority for her government.
